Croatia Culture and History Tours – The Roman Legacy of Split and Diocletian’s Palace

Leaving behind Dubrovnik’s medieval grandeur, you’ll find that Croatia’s historical narrative gains new dimensions in Split, where ancient Rome left an indelible mark on the Adriatic coast.

As you wander through Split’s labyrinthine streets, you’re actually stepping inside Diocletian’s Palace—an immense fortress and imperial residence built at the turn of the 4th century.

Here, walls of weathered limestone blend seamlessly with vibrant city life, a striking testament to adaptive reuse across centuries.

The Enchanting Castles of Northern Croatia

Hidden among the rolling hills and dense forests of northern Croatia, a collection of castles stands as silent witnesses to centuries of intrigue, power, and artistry.

When you step inside Trakošćan Castle, you’ll sense the legacy of noble families who shaped the nation’s destiny, their portraits watching over ornate halls.

Veliki Tabor rises dramatically, its massive walls once guarding secrets and legends that still echo through its corridors.

Each fortress and manor reveals how foreign influences blended with local traditions, reflecting Austria-Hungary’s reach and Croatia’s enduring spirit.

Religious Landmarks and Spiritual Journeys

Travelers flock to Croatia’s sacred sites for more than beauty—they seek the timeless story of faith woven through history.

When you enter Dubrovnik’s Franciscan Monastery or gaze up at the spires of Zagreb Cathedral, you’re not merely witnessing architectural excellence. You’re stepping into living history, where Catholic, Orthodox, and Islamic traditions intersect and shape community identities.

Sites like the Basilica of Euphrasius in Poreč reveal Byzantine influences, while Trogir’s St. Lawrence Cathedral echoes Romanesque artistry.
